As described above, all dietitians are nutritional experts yet not all nutritional experts have the credentials and credentials to be called dietitians.
This indicates precisely the exact same thing as Registered Dietitian (RD), a term that has actually been in usage for a lengthy time. While accreditation to become an RD or RDN is governed by the Academy of Nourishment and Dietetics a nationwide company licensure is managed by individual states.
In order to offer medical nourishment therapy and certify as companies for insurance provider, a dietitian has to be certified by the state. According to the Bureau of Labor Data, the demand for dietitians and nutritional experts is expected to increase by 20% in between 2010 and 2020 this is a much faster development rate than the average for all occupations.
There are considerable differences in compensation based on specialization, with Clinical Pediatric Dietitians and Dairy products Nutritionists averaging roughly $90,000. In 2014, The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) located that the top 10% of dietitians and nutritional experts gain even more than $79,000, and the bottom 10% much less than $36,000 - Registered Dietitian Nutritionist. A mean hourly wage of $27.62 was determined for both fields, with the leading 10% earning above $38.00 per hour, and the lower 10% earning listed below $17.00 per hour

Along with participating in an approved program, many states need dietitians to be certified or to have professional accreditation, or both. On the other hand, only regarding half of states call for such qualifications for nutritional experts. Nevertheless, several professional duties for nutritionists require at least a bachelor's level, and the same qualification is readily available for nutritionists and dietitians alike.
Your core classes might include: Food science Chemistry Health and wellness care policy Scientific nourishment Biostatistics Microbiology Food solution management You'll also require to complete a dietetic teaching fellowship.
And to advance in the field, you'll likely require a master's degree. Whether created in legislation or not, dietitians and nutritional experts many times need a comparable education. Usual bachelor's levels for nutritional experts consist of nourishment science or a relevant technique, such as dietetics, kinesiology, food system monitoring, or biochemistry and biology. A few of your courses could include: Fads in nourishment Biomedical data Scientific nutrition Food, nourishment, and habits Nutritional ecology Area nutrition Physiology Some degree programs consist of teaching fellowships, but in others you'll have to locate possibilities on your very own.
The number of hours you'll need may rely on needs in the state where you'll work. Whether you intend to gain a credential or otherwise, it's an excellent idea to finish at the very least one internship to obtain valuable experience prior to seeking a full time duty. Licensing and certification needs for nutritionists and dietitians differ from one state to another.

Bureau of Labor Stats places dietitians and nutritionists in the very same classification and claims they gain a median yearly wage of $69,680. Yet there is a range in wages, with the lower 10% around $44,910 and the top 10% around $98,830, according to the BLS. Nutritional expert and dietitian roles are anticipated to expand 6.6% via 2032, according to the BLS.

There are numerous distinctions in between diet professionals and nutritional experts. Right here are the training and history specs. Diet professionals usually hold a bachelor's degree in dietetics, nourishment, or a relevant area. As their jobs advance, many dieticians pursue innovative levels, like a Master's or Doctorate, to be experts in certain areas of nutrition. Dieticians should undertake monitored functional training as component of their education to gain hands-on experience in medical setups, area nutrition programs, or food service management.
